What to do if there are white spots on the leaves of rubber trees

1. Watering

It is drought-resistant but not water-resistant, and is very afraid of waterlogging. Once it is watered too much and water accumulates, it will corrode its roots and make it unable to absorb nutrients from the soil normally. In addition, if the water temperature is too low, its roots may be easily frozen, causing it to be unable to absorb nutrients. The above conditions will cause white spots to appear on its leaves.

Solution: Control the amount of watering reasonably, not too much. In addition, when watering, you also need to pay attention to the water temperature not being too low to avoid freezing its roots.

2. Ventilation

This is also an important factor. If it is insufficient, it may prevent it from carrying out normal physiological responses, causing it to be unable to grow normally and white spots to appear on the leaves.

Solution: Pay attention to ventilation at ordinary times, but be careful not to put it in an air-conditioned room in winter.

3. Diseases and pests

This is the most likely reason. If it gets some diseases, such as anthrax, white spots may appear on its leaves. Generally, it occurs at the tip or edge of the leaf. If it is serious, it may affect the entire leaf surface.

Solution: Once it is confirmed that it is diseased, we need to pick off those with white spots, and then spray it with commonly used drugs such as carbendazim. If it is a scale insect, there is no need to make such a big fuss. Generally, it will appear on the branches. If we press it with our fingers, liquid will be produced. At this time, we can directly scrape it off, because this kind of pest will die if it leaves the plant, so we just need to clean it up. In addition, we can also directly purchase some insecticides, which are generally available on the market. If there are white marks on the leaves after spraying the medicine, don't rush to wipe them off, because these are residual medicine. The efficacy will be better if you leave them for a while.
